Condividi tramite


Classe VSColorTable

Fornisce i colori utilizzati per gli elementi di visualizzazione di Visual Studio.

Gerarchia di ereditarietà

System.Object
  System.Windows.Forms.ProfessionalColorTable
    Microsoft.VisualStudio.VSColorTable

Spazio dei nomi:  Microsoft.VisualStudio
Assembly:  Microsoft.VisualStudio (in Microsoft.VisualStudio.dll)

Sintassi

'Dichiarazione
Public Class VSColorTable _
    Inherits ProfessionalColorTable
public class VSColorTable : ProfessionalColorTable
public ref class VSColorTable : public ProfessionalColorTable
type VSColorTable =  
    class
        inherit ProfessionalColorTable
    end
public class VSColorTable extends ProfessionalColorTable

Il tipo VSColorTable espone i seguenti membri.

Proprietà

  Nome Descrizione
Proprietà pubblica ButtonCheckedGradientBegin Ottiene il colore iniziale della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onCheckedGradientBegin).
Proprietà pubblica ButtonCheckedGradientEnd Ottiene il colore finale della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onCheckedGradientEnd).
Proprietà pubblica ButtonCheckedGradientMiddle Ottiene il colore intermedio della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onCheckedGradientMiddle).
Proprietà pubblica ButtonCheckedHighlight Ottiene la tinta unita utilizzata quando il pulsante viene controllato.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ButtonCheckedHighlightBorder Ottiene il colore del bordo per l'utilizzo con ButtonCheckedHighlight.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ButtonFace Ottiene il colore utilizzato per disegnare il lato di un elemento tridimensionale.
Proprietà pubblica ButtonPressedBorder Ottiene il colore del bordo da utilizzare con i colori ButtonPressedGradientBegin, ButtonPressedGradientMiddle e ButtonPressedGradientEnd. (Esegue l'override di ProfessionalColorTable.ButtonPressedBorder).
Proprietà pubblica ButtonPressedGradientBegin Ottiene il colore iniziale della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onPressedGradientBegin).
Proprietà pubblica ButtonPressedGradientEnd Ottiene il colore finale della sfumatura utilizzata quando si preme il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onPressedGradientEnd).
Proprietà pubblica ButtonPressedGradientMiddle Ottiene il colore intermedio della sfumatura utilizzata quando si preme il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onPressedGradientMiddle).
Proprietà pubblica ButtonPressedHighlight Ottiene la tinta unita utilizzata quando viene premuto il pulsante.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ButtonPressedHighlightBorder Ottiene il colore del bordo per l'utilizzo con ButtonPressedHighlight.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ButtonSelectedBorder Ottiene il colore del bordo da utilizzare con i colori ButtonSelectedGradientBegin, ButtonSelectedGradientMiddle e ButtonSelectedGradientEnd. (Esegue l'override di ProfessionalColorTable.ButtonSelectedBorder).
Proprietà pubblica ButtonSelectedGradientBegin Ottiene il colore iniziale della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onSelectedGradientBegin).
Proprietà pubblica ButtonSelectedGradientEnd Ottiene il colore finale della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onSelectedGradientEnd).
Proprietà pubblica ButtonSelectedGradientMiddle Ottiene il colore intermedio della sfumatura utilizzata qu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onSelectedGradientMiddle).
Proprietà pubblica ButtonSelectedHighlight Ottiene il colore a tinta unita utilizzato quando si seleziona il pulsante. (Esegue l'override di ProfessionalColorTable.ButtonSelectedHighlight).
Proprietà pubblica ButtonSelectedHighlightBorder Ottiene il colore del bordo per l'utilizzo con ButtonSelectedHighlight.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ButtonText Ottiene il colore utilizzato per creare il testo in un elemento tridimensionale.
Proprietà pubblica CheckBackground Ottiene il colore a tinta unita da utilizzare quando si seleziona il pulsante e vengono utilizzate le sfumature. (Esegue l'override di ProfessionalColorTable.CheckBackground).
Proprietà pubblica CheckPressedBackground Ottiene il colore a tinta unita da utilizzare quando si seleziona il pulsante e vengono utilizzate le selezioni e le sfumature. (Esegue l'override di ProfessionalColorTable.CheckPressedBackground).
Proprietà pubblica CheckSelectedBackground Ottiene il colore a tinta unita da utilizzare quando si seleziona il pulsante e vengono utilizzate le selezioni e le sfumature. (Esegue l'override di ProfessionalColorTable.CheckSelectedBackground).
Proprietà pubblica GripDark Ottiene il colore da utilizzare per gli effetti ombreggiatura sul riquadro o sull'handle di spostamento. (Esegue l'override di ProfessionalColorTable.GripDark).
Proprietà pubblica GripLight Ottiene il colore da utilizzare per gli effetti evidenziazione sul riquadro o sull'handle di spostamento. (Esegue l'override di ProfessionalColorTable.GripLight).
Proprietà pubblica Highlight Ottiene il colore utilizzato per disegnare lo sfondo degli elementi selezionati.
Proprietà pubblica HighlightText Ottiene il colore utilizzato per disegnare il testo degli elementi selezionati.
Proprietà pubblica ImageMarginGradientBegin Ottiene il colore iniziale della sfumatura utilizzata per il margine dell'immagine di un oggetto ToolStripDropDownMenu. (Esegue l'override di ProfessionalColorTable.ImageMarginGradientBegin).
Proprietà pubblica ImageMarginGradientEnd Ottiene il colore finale della sfumatura utilizzata per il margine dell'immagine di un oggetto ToolStripDropDownMenu. (Esegue l'override di ProfessionalColorTable.ImageMarginGradientEnd).
Proprietà pubblica ImageMarginGradientMiddle Ottiene il colore intermedio della sfumatura utilizzata per il margine dell'immagine di un oggetto ToolStripDropDownMenu. (Esegue l'override di ProfessionalColorTable.ImageMarginGradientMiddle).
Proprietà pubblica ImageMarginRevealedGradientBegin Ottiene il colore iniziale della sfumatura utilizzata nel margine dell'immagine di un oggetto ToolStripDropDownMenu quando un elemento è rivelato.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ImageMarginRevealedGradientEnd Ottiene il colore finale della sfumatura utilizzata nel margine dell'immagine di un oggetto ToolStripDropDownMenu quando un elemento è rivelato.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ImageMarginRevealedGradientMiddle Ottiene il colore centrale della sfumatura utilizzata nel margine dell'immagine di un oggetto ToolStripDropDownMenu quando un elemento è rivelato. (Ereditato da ProfessionalColorTable)
Proprietà pubblica MenuBorder Ottiene il colore del bordo da utilizzare su un oggetto MenuStrip. (Esegue l'override di ProfessionalColorTable.MenuBorder).
Proprietà pubblica MenuItemBorder Ottiene il colore del bordo da utilizzare con un oggetto ToolStripMenuItem. (Esegue l'override di ProfessionalColorTable.MenuItemBorder).
Proprietà pubblica MenuItemPressedGradientBegin Ottiene il colore iniziale della sfumatura utilizzata quando un livello superiore ToolStripMenuItem viene premuto. (Ereditato da ProfessionalColorTable)
Proprietà pubblica MenuItemPressedGradientEnd Ottiene il colore finale della sfumatura utilizzata quando un livello superiore ToolStripMenuItem viene premuto. (Ereditato da ProfessionalColorTable)
Proprietà pubblica MenuItemPressedGradientMiddle Ottiene il colore centrale della sfumatura utilizzata quando un livello superiore ToolStripMenuItem viene premuto. (Ereditato da ProfessionalColorTable)
Proprietà pubblica MenuItemSelected Ottiene il colore a tinta unita da utilizzare quando si seleziona un oggetto ToolStripMenuItem diverso da un oggetto ToolStripMenuItem di primo livello. (Esegue l'override di ProfessionalColorTable.MenuItemSelected).
Proprietà pubblica MenuItemSelectedGradientBegin Ottiene il colore iniziale della sfumatura utilizzata quando si seleziona l'oggetto ToolStripMenuItem. (Esegue l'override di ProfessionalColorTable.MenuItemSelectedGradientBegin).
Proprietà pubblica MenuItemSelectedGradientEnd Ottiene il colore finale della sfumatura utilizzata quando si seleziona l'oggetto ToolStripMenuItem. (Esegue l'override di ProfessionalColorTable.MenuItemSelectedGradientEnd).
Proprietà pubblica MenuStripGradientBegin Ottiene il colore iniziale della sfumatura utilizzata nell'oggetto MenuStrip. (Esegue l'override di ProfessionalColorTable.MenuStripGradientBegin).
Proprietà pubblica MenuStripGradientEnd Ottiene il colore finale della sfumatura utilizzata nell'oggetto MenuStrip. (Esegue l'override di ProfessionalColorTable.MenuStripGradientEnd).
Proprietà pubblica OverflowButtonGradientBegin Ottiene il colore iniziale della sfumatura utilizzata nell'oggetto ToolStripOverflowButton. (Esegue l'override di ProfessionalColorTable.OverflowButtonGradientBegin).
Proprietà pubblica OverflowButtonGradientEnd Ottiene il colore finale della sfumatura utilizzata nell'oggetto ToolStripOverflowButton. (Esegue l'override di ProfessionalColorTable.OverflowButtonGradientEnd).
Proprietà pubblica OverflowButtonGradientMiddle Ottiene il colore intermedio della sfumatura utilizzata nell'oggetto ToolStripOverflowButton. (Esegue l'override di ProfessionalColorTable.OverflowButtonGradientMiddle).
Proprietà pubblica RaftingContainerGradientBegin Ottiene il colore iniziale della sfumatura utilizzata nell'oggetto ToolStripContainer. (Esegue l'override di ProfessionalColorTable.RaftingContainerGradientBegin).
Proprietà pubblica RaftingContainerGradientEnd Ottiene il colore finale della sfumatura utilizzata nell'oggetto ToolStripContainer. (Esegue l'override di ProfessionalColorTable.RaftingContainerGradientEnd).
Proprietà pubblica SeparatorDark Ottiene il colore da utilizzare per gli effetti ombreggiatura sull'oggetto ToolStripSeparator. (Esegue l'override di ProfessionalColorTable.SeparatorDark).
Proprietà pubblica SeparatorLight Ottiene il colore da utilizzare per gli effetti evidenziazione sull'oggetto ToolStripSeparator. (Esegue l'override di ProfessionalColorTable.SeparatorLight).
Proprietà pubblica StatusStripGradientBegin Ottiene il colore iniziale della sfumatura utilizzata da StatusStrip. (Ereditato da ProfessionalColorTable)
Proprietà pubblica StatusStripGradientEnd Ottiene il colore finale della sfumatura utilizzata da StatusStrip.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ToolStripBorder Ottiene il colore da utilizzare sul bordo inferiore dell'oggetto ToolStrip. (Esegue l'override di ProfessionalColorTable.ToolStripBorder).
Proprietà pubblica ToolStripContentPanelGradientBegin Ottiene il colore iniziale della sfumatura utilizzata in ToolStripContentPanel.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ToolStripContentPanelGradientEnd Ottiene il colore finale della sfumatura utilizzata in ToolStripContentPanel.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ToolStripDropDownBackground Ottiene il colore di sfondo a tinta unita dell'oggetto ToolStripDropDown. (Esegue l'override di ProfessionalColorTable.ToolStripDropDownBackground).
Proprietà pubblica ToolStripGradientBegin Ottiene il colore iniziale della sfumatura utilizzata nello sfondo ToolStrip. (Esegue l'override di ProfessionalColorTable.ToolStripGradientBegin).
Proprietà pubblica ToolStripGradientEnd Ottiene il colore finale della sfumatura utilizzata nello sfondo ToolStrip. (Esegue l'override di ProfessionalColorTable.ToolStripGradientEnd).
Proprietà pubblica ToolStripGradientMiddle Ottiene il colore intermedio della sfumatura utilizzata nello sfondo ToolStrip. (Esegue l'override di ProfessionalColorTable.ToolStripGradientMiddle).
Proprietà pubblica ToolStripPanelGradientBegin Ottiene il colore iniziale della sfumatura utilizzata in ToolStripPanel.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ToolStripPanelGradientEnd Ottiene il colore finale della sfumatura utilizzata in ToolStripPanel. (Ereditato da ProfessionalColorTable)
Proprietà pubblica ToolWindowBackground Ottiene il colore utilizzato per disegnare lo sfondo di una finestra degli strumenti.
Proprietà pubblica ToolWindowText Ottiene il colore utilizzato per creare testo sullo sfondo di una finestra degli strumenti.
Proprietà pubblica UseSystemColors Ottiene o imposta un valore che indica se utilizzare SystemColors invece dei colori che corrispondono allo stile visivo corrente. (Ereditato da ProfessionalColorTable)

In alto

Metodi

  Nome Descrizione
Metodo pubblico Equals Determina se l'oggetto specificato equivale all'oggetto corrente. (Ereditato da Object)
Metodo protetto Finalize Consente a un oggetto di provare a liberare risorse ed eseguire altre operazioni di pulitura prima che l'oggetto stesso venga recuperato dalla procedura di Garbage Collection. (Ereditato da Object)
Metodo pubblico GetHashCode Funge da funzione hash per un determinato tipo. (Ereditato da Object)
Metodo pubblico GetType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object)
Metodo protetto MemberwiseClone Consente di creare una copia dei riferimenti dell'oggetto Object corrente. (Ereditato da Object)
Metodo pubblico ToString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object)

In alto

Note

L'interfaccia IUIService deve essere utilizzata per ottenere un'istanza VSColorTable. VSColorTable è possibile accedere tramite IUIService. Styles["VSColorTable"].

Codice thread safe

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.

Vedere anche

Riferimenti

Spazio dei nomi Microsoft.VisualStudio